The study seeks to prove that the use of Techniques of Responsive Feeding contributes to improvement of eating habits through the acceptance of new foods in children 2 to 3 years old. The study is an applied type, descriptive level and a cross-sectional descriptive design. The population was consisted of 66 preschool children from an educational institution, called I.E.I. “Niño Jesús de Praga”, in 2014. The observation instrument for caregivers was applied. In addition, the Chi-square statistical test was employed to measure the significance level of the study. The research was experimental, applicative, pre- and post-test. A sample of 24 Holtzman rats, 1.5 months, weight 210 g (control group and two experimental groups, 8 rats with intake of the extract 1.5 ml and 3 ml) was taken for the study. The bioactive compounds found in the passion fruit extract were: Vitamin C (11.9 mg/100 ml), Antioxidant capacity (23531.6 u mol Trolox /100ml), Polyphenols 480.64 ±0.31 mg Ác. Gallic Acid /100 ml. The averages of atherogenic indexes I, II, III, IV after ingestion were: For the control group 3.31, 1.96, 2.31 and 1.53; for the group (1.5 ml) they were 3.14, 1.84, 2.14, 1.53 and for the group (3 ml) they were 3.52, 2.11, 2.52, 1.89, respectively. The amounts of HDL obtained after ingestion of passion fruit extract had a significant influence on the reduction of atherogenic indices, which had a positive effect, reducing cardiovascular risk factors.

 Chronic kidney disease is a progressive disease that affects the glomeruli. The objective of this research was to establish the nutritional and dietary requirements of the elderly with chronic kidney disease on ambulatory hemodialysis. The study was descriptive level of secondary sources and the population was older adults with hemodialysis. The study subject requires 1.1 to 1.2 g / kg protein weight to cover the protein turnover rate and losses during hemodialysis; likewise, sodium, potassium and phosphorus requirements are reduced; as for the others, macro and micronutrients sufficient according to the adequacy for the elderly. The following conclusion was reached: The nutritional requirement is modified by increasing the intake of protein and energy, reducing and controlling food sources of sodium, potassium, phosphorus and water.

Antarctica, the White Continent, is the refuge of typical species, where temperatures range from -85 to 2 oC, UV radiation can penetrate 30 m depth and salinity reaches 32-34%. Among these species, brown macroalgae (Pheophytas) and red macroalgae (Rhodophytas) are mainly evaluated as potential food and health resources for mankind. The macroalgae collected in February 2019 were taxonomically classified into 6 species: Desmarestia confervoides, (hacer la consulta con el autor/IMARPE) Desmarestia antarctica, Himantothallus grandifolius, Palmaria decipiens, Gigartina skottsbergii and Curdiea racovitzae. This research determined organic matter ranging from 12 to 20%, iron (atomic absorption), polyphenols and flavonoids (quantitative methods).
